Tuthill Porsche GT One

Tuthill Porsche has unveiled the mighty GT ONE at Monterey Car Week, a stunning tribute to the iconic 1990s FIA GT1 race cars, now reimagined for the road. Designed by California-based Florian Flatau, this limited-edition supercar boasts a full carbon fiber body, delivering both strength and agility.

Under the hood, the GT ONE features a 4.0L flat-six engine, available in naturally aspirated (500+ hp) and forced induction (600+ hp) versions. With options for a 7-speed dual-clutch or manual gearbox, it offers a tailored driving experience. Advanced engineering includes twin wishbone suspension, carbon ceramic brakes, and a lightweight 2,645 lbs frame.

Only 22 units will be produced, each requiring 3,500 hours of meticulous craftsmanship. The GT ONE combines Tuthill's engineering excellence with motorsport heritage, creating a unique blend of track performance and street usability.
